YEADON THEATRE COMPANY
OPERATIC & DRAMATIC SOCIETY.
Financial health, per its FY2025 accounts
The accounts state that the charity holds unrestricted funds of £78,219, an increase from £62,435 in the prior year, with no debt and a positive net income of £15,784. The trustees confirm there are no material uncertainties regarding the charity's ability to continue as a going concern. The charity maintains a reasonable bank balance to mitigate cashflow risks associated with staging performances.

Income and spending
| Financial year end |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 30/04/2025 | £57k | £42k |
| 30/04/2024 | £65k | £47k |
| 30/04/2023 | £50k | £38k |
| 30/04/2022 | £25k | £31k |
| 30/04/2021 | £3k | £5k |
